Sat 763029342127203

decimal
152605.4342127203
degree
0°152605′1405″4342127203‴
percentile
36.33473061745408%
name
ilfgknbhltu
cycle
0
epoch
0
period
75
block
152605
offset
4342127203
timestamp
rarity
common